Output 918109217072ad56c975e8a3ece65de21957300f05c11a552b9fcab8681ffad8:21

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29840cc4b1512e73a5f34918795da43579b23def OP_EQUAL
address
35UXpPsDSsABZMhWnfVnsxfqwvF5idM8sW
transaction
918109217072ad56c975e8a3ece65de21957300f05c11a552b9fcab8681ffad8
spent
true